a PROSTHESIS How is an impression taken for 05 an Axiom®D implant? Depending on the case and the planned prosthetic restoration, there are 2 possible solutions for taking the impres- sion: on the implant or on the abutment. The impression on implant is made directly with a pop-in type transfer. The prosthesis and any alterations to the abutment are carried out in the laboratory. MATERIAL REQUIRED Pop-In Implant Threaded gripping device transfer analog Ref. OPCF100 Ref. OPPI028 Ref. OPIA028 1 2 1. Procedures in the mouth Remove the healing plug with a threaded gripping device Ref. OPCF100 1 2 Insert the Pop-In transfer into the implant with manual pressure 3 4 3 4 Take an impression using a commercially available impression tray (closed tray impression). Once the material has hardened, care- fully remove the impression tray*. *See recommendations of the impression material manufacturer.
